Ingredients

serves 8
  • 2 pounds small new potatoes (red or yellow)
  • 4 cups low-sodium chicken broth or stock
  • 1 pound andouille or kielbasa sausage (cut into 1-inch pieces)
  • 4 ears fresh corn (husked and quartered)
  • 2 tablespoons Old Bay seasoning
  • ½ teaspoon cayenne pepper (more or less depending on taste)
  • 2 pounds large shrimp (tails on)
  • 4 tablespoons butter (melted)
  • 2 tablespoons chopped parsley
  • cocktail sauce for dipping
  • lemon wedges
